What You'll Do as a Groundperson

You'll be on the right hand of our tree crews, supporting vegetation management for utility partners and various other customers.

  • Clear vegetation and debris from work sites around power lines (Tree pruning, vegetation removal, lift logs, drag brush, etc.)
  • Operate and maintain tools and equipment like chainsaws, chippers, blowers, and sprayers
  • Assist climbers by spotting from the ground, handing up tools, and using hand lines
  • Assist with rigging and felling of trees
  • Safeguard colleagues and the public from hazards in and around the work area
  • Apply herbicides (with proper certification) to manage growth
  • Maintain clean, organized trucks and job sites
  • Set up traffic control zones and direct traffic when needed
  • Travel frequently (including overnight stays) to different job sites
  • Participate in safety briefings and follow all company safety protocols

Physical Demands

Ability to:

  • Lift 50 lbs. to shoulder height or higher
  • Push or pull up to 50 lbs.
  • Walk or hike up to one mile on uneven terrain
  • Endure extreme climate variances (e.g., severe cold to high heat and humidity)
  • Hear, speak, see, and communicate effectively
  • Operate two-handed tools and equipment

Continuously - Standing, Walking, Handling/Grasping, Repetitive Movements.

Frequently - Lifting/Carrying, Pushing/Pulling, Stooping/Kneeling, Reaching.

Occasionally - Driving, Climbing Stairs/Ladders.

Rarely - Sitting, Operating,

Never - Tree Ascending/Descending

Comments : You should expect variability in size, proportions, conditions, and weights of supplies, equipment, and work conditions.

Environmental Conditions:

Continuously - Outdoor work

Occasionally - Noise Levels

Frequently - Extreme Temperatures

Rarely - Contact with hazardous materials or air quality issues

Never - Confined Spaces

Comments: You should expect variability based on regional weather patterns. Personal protective equipment is required to be worn by OSHA and ANSI.

Equipment may include:

  • Aerial lift trucks, dump trucks, ATVs
  • Chainsaws, pole saws, handsaws, chipper
  • Blowers, pruners, pole pruners, rakes, winches, ropes
  • Climbing gear: harness, chaps, spikes
  • Sprayers, herbicide applicators, fuel, cones, signs
  • Tablets and communication devices
